Infographic: Journalists Want Brands to Provide Multimedia-Rich Content

Beyond PR

According to the Cision 2017 State of the Media Report , when communicators pair compelling messages with rich formats like photos, videos, social media posts, infographics and data, they can drive better and more accurate coverage and increase earned media opportunities. The top three elements include photos, social media posts and videos.

Google’s Cookie Ban May Put a Brighter Spotlight on Original Content

Contently - Strategy

In early March 2021, Google announced plans to phase out third-party cookies by 2022, sending the targeted advertising industry into a tailspin. For brands, however, it means a paradigm shift. Brands and advertisers have long relied on cookies to learn more about users’ location, interests, and buying behavior.
